rotation in the garden

by "0tterbot" <spl@[EMAIL PROTECTED] > May 6, 2008 at 12:26 AM

have realised what my problem is re rotating the garden beds in an
organised 
manner:

1: lots of brassicas. i seem to grow half brassicas & half other stuff!! 
(only slight exaggeration). this makes rotation difficult! in summer, lots

of solanacae (sp!) as well, of course, which have to be somewhere
different 
each season.

2: not everything comes out at the same time - the garden goes all year. 
(how is one to rotate in this circumstance?!) i try to keep a record &
then 
consider what was in each section of each bed - the entire bed isn't taken

as a whole because they're quite long, with perhaps up to 10 different 
things along the length - and only in the same family if it's worked out 
that way. if it hasn't worked out that way, i can't do it.

in a nutshell, if i rotate as best i can but still grow lots of brassica,
am 
i setting myself up for a disease disaster? i simply cannot think how to 
plan good rotations under this circumstance. with the brassica i take out 
the entire roots, so each location gets a rest - is that enough?

the whole family is now in love with chinese cabbage & pak choy, so if i
am 
setting up a problem, it is only going to get worse.

thanks for any help or ideas!
